A penetration tester is a cybersecurity professional who evaluates the security measures of a system or network by simulating cyber attacks. The goal is to identify vulnerabilities and weaknesses that attackers could exploit.
Key Features
- Testing for vulnerabilities in systems
- Evaluating security measures
- Simulating cyber attacks
- Providing recommendations for improvement
- Ensuring data protection and confidentiality
Pros
- Helps organizations identify and fix security weaknesses
- Assists in protecting sensitive data and preventing breaches
- Provides valuable insights into potential threats and risks
Cons
- Penetration testing can be time-consuming and labor-intensive
- Requires specialized knowledge and skills in cybersecurity
- May not catch all possible vulnerabilities
